016128<p>Actually the Bronx River Expressway which in the mid-sixties was officially designated the Sheridan Expressway. A problematic stretch of road since its construction in 1963 viable solutions for its demolition or re-use have come and gone. Solomon here proposes thirteen projects to integrate the road into contemporary urbanization. <br />First edition Pamphlet Architecture 26. 21.5 cm; 80 pp.; illustrated from photographs plans and drawings. Spent nuclear fuel has a value that varies depending upon the timing and nature of its eventual use. The present discounted value of spent fuel that is to be recycled into light water reactors is a function of interim storage costs the value of the fissile plutonium and uranium in the spent fuel and excess costs associated with using mixed-oxide fuels instead of uranium oxide fuels. With parametric equations describing the present discounted value of spent fuel it is possible to evaluate the impact of uncertainties in critical variables e.g. yellowcake price and reprocessing cost on spent fuel value. Such a procedure may be useful in negotiations related to the international transfer of spent fuel. In such negotiations different parties will have varying perceptions of critical parameters.
